Why the Content On Your Website is Important

1/2/2021

0 Comments

 
why content is important_website designers romford_perfect layout digital marketing
Keywords used to reign supreme with regards to SEO, but those days are long since past. The rules of SEO have changed from a keyword-centered scheme to a topic-driven approach. Content marketing is a vital part of inbound marketing, where the goal is to move your potential customer to where you want them to go by giving them valuable and compelling content. 

​Your site's content should be relevant to what your site is about and not randomly packed with keywords. Your content should be engaging and seize the user's attention straight away. It is a vital building block in creating content for your website so that it won't have a high bounce rate. Don't fall behind your competitors with antiquated thinking about how content should be created to improve your SEO. The key is content, not just keywords.

​In the past few years, search engines have steadily moved towards semantic-based searches. Even with that important fact, keywords are still vital to SEO, but well written relevant content is what search engines like Google and Bing seek. 

​There is little doubt that selecting the right keywords and topics is vital to connecting with your customers and giving them value, but the dynamics have shifted. Let's take a closer look at how content will improve your SEO.

Here is what happens when you concentrate on topics first:
  • Learn new possibilities to craft content to drive traffic and is also relevant to your goods or services.
  • Keywords are and most likely will always be needed for search engines and users. Each time someone searches for something on Google or Bing, we search for highlighted or bold-faced keywords; these highlighted words are an exact match to titles and meta descriptions that serve as a guide to what link to click.

Next, let's look at a vital factor in why the content on your website is important; your customer's experience.

User Experience (UX)
Having your site focused on UX design is an excellent way to ensure your customers don't get frustrated and can easily find what they want. Another massive component of UX design is content. If your blog has content that is five years old; you are giving your customer nothing of value, and search engines will look at your site as being inactive. 

Constantly updating content gives your customers a reason to return and allows search engines to view our website as active. There are several ways you can use content to enhance customer experience. It provides informative and useful content such as in-depth information on a product you sell or updates about a service field in which your company is involved.

Content Builds Brand Trust
When you regularly post relevant and informative content, you will gain the trust of your customers. They are more likely to return if they know you are an authority on the services or goods you provide. By giving them helpful content that can improve their daily lives, you build brand trust and long-term brand loyalty. 

In Conclusion
If you want to improve both your SEO efforts and customer experience, good, relevant, regular content is what your website needs.
